You open a brand new Fluke multimeter and the first thing you notice is the bright yellow case. It looks like a piece of plastic from a child’s toy box, not a serious electrical tool. This makes many people worry they bought a fake or cheap product.
Fluke intentionally uses that bright yellow color and rugged plastic for high visibility on dangerous job sites. The thick casing is actually a protective holster designed to survive a six-foot drop onto concrete. That toy-like appearance hides a professional-grade instrument built for safety and durability.

How I Learned to Spot a Real Fluke From a Fake
The First Clue Is Always the Weight
Honestly, the easiest way to tell a real Fluke from a toy is to pick it up. A genuine Fluke multimeter has a solid, dense feel in your hand.
Fake meters feel hollow and light, like a cheap plastic Easter egg. I have held counterfeits that rattled when I shook them. That is a dead giveaway.
Real Fluke meters use high-quality components inside that thick case. The weight comes from real safety engineering, not just a chunk of metal added for show.
Check the Input Jacks and Leads
Look closely at the input jacks on the front of the meter. On a real Fluke, these jacks are recessed and have a tight, precise fit.
Fake meters often have loose jacks that feel wobbly when you plug in a lead. That is a serious safety hazard because a loose connection can arc or give you a false reading.
The leads themselves are another giveaway. Real Fluke leads have thick insulation and a flexible silicone feel. Counterfeit leads are stiff and crack easily.

What I Look for When Buying a Multimeter That Looks Like a Real Tool
When I help a friend pick a meter, I ignore the fancy features on the box. I focus on three things that actually keep you safe and save you money.
Safety Ratings Printed on the Case
Look for the CAT rating printed right on the front of the meter. You want CAT III for most home and shop work, and CAT IV for service entrance panels.
A toy-looking meter might be bright yellow but have no safety rating at all. That means it is not tested for surges and could explode in your hands.
I always check that the rating is molded into the plastic, not just printed on a sticker. Stickers peel off. Molded ratings are permanent.
How the Dial Feels When You Turn It
Turn the dial slowly and feel the clicks. A quality meter has firm, positive detents that stop exactly on each setting.
Cheap meters have a loose, mushy dial that slides past settings. I once had a cheap meter slip from volts to ohms without me noticing, and it took me an hour to find the problem.
That loose dial cost me time and frustration. Now I check the dial feel before I even plug in the leads.
The Backlight and Display Quality
Turn the meter on and look at the screen from an angle. A good display stays clear and readable even when you are not looking straight at it.
I work in dark crawl spaces and bright sunlight. If the backlight is dim or the numbers wash out in sunlight, the meter is useless for real work.
Test this by holding the meter near a window or under a bright shop light before you buy. You will see the difference immediately.

Why does Fluke use such cheap-looking plastic on expensive meters?
That plastic is not cheap at all. It is a rugged, impact-resistant material designed to survive drops from six feet or more. Metal cases look premium but dent and crack.
The plastic also provides electrical insulation. A metal case could conduct electricity if something went wrong. That yellow shell is actually a safety feature protecting you.
